Board Bill Number 77 Votes | Session 2020-2021
Ballot Measure for 28 Wards
Board Bill
This Board Bill would submit to the qualified voters of the City of St. Louis a proposed amendment to the Charter of the City of St. Louis to maintain the Board of Aldermen as body of twenty-eight Aldermen representing twenty-eight wards, and preventing its reduction beginning December 31, 2021and containing an emergency clause.
